Disciple Our Nations Effectively (D.O.N.E.)
About D.O.N.E.
Discipling Our Nations Effectively (D.O.N.E.) is a multi-faceted non-denominational
West African ministry. This Sub-Saharan ministry was founded in 1995 in
Liberia with current African headquarters located in Dakar, Senegal.
The ministry operates in many countries in the Sub-Saharan of West Africa.
Their workers are African born and raised and brought to faith in Christ while
in Africa. National coordinators live in the countries where ministry activities
are happening. They're responsible for providing the monthly field reports
with the current ministry activities of that country. Reports include prayer
needs, evangelization updates, church planting progress, existing church
activities, etc. These reports keep supporters of D.O.N.E. informed of the
progress and goals of ministry activities.

The D.O.N.E. Mission
The ministry D.O.N.E. Inc. operates in the region of West Africa.
The D.O.N.E. Inc. mission is to make disciples and evangelize among Muslims,
Animist, nominal Christians and all unreached peoples of our target areas, into
growing disciples of Jesus Christ by employing contextually relevant strategies
primarily, but not exclusively, through the holistic ministry of trained national
workers in accordance with the mandate of the great commission as recorded
in
Matthew 28:19-20.
This area is dominated ninety percent by the Islamic religion, one hundred
percent by poverty disease famine desert, and thousands of displaced refugees
fleeing from war or some other pestilence. In eighty percent of the area where we
operate there is a high risk to both the pastors and the convert and often they

The D.O.N.E. Vision
The vision of DONE is to disciple, train, evangelize and plant
reproductive churches among all un-evangelized, unreached, hidden
peoples, primarily but not exclusively in areas where there are no
gospel witness, originating in the region of West Africa. |
